Alexander McLean Secures Victory in the Squibb Group Pony Foxhunter Second Round at Bishop Burton

Alexander McLean from Lasswade, Midlothian secured a commanding victory on Tobar King in the Squibb Group Pony Foxhunter Second Round at Bishop Burton College, East Yorkshire.  The win registers his qualification place for the Squibb Group Pony Foxhunter Championship Final held at this year’s Horse of the Year Show at Birmingham’s NEC in October.

A field of forty-six initially chased the three coveted Horse of the Year Show qualifying places, but only nine produced first round clears and these were further whittled down to seven for the final jump-off.  

Alexander Mclean produced the goods mid-draw, cruising into the top spot on the Irish-bred 9-year-old gelding Tobar King owned by Marjory McNaughton.  

They remained unmoved as challenges came and went, nearest rival sixteen year-old Ella Popely from Peterborough, Cambridgeshire and the 13-year-old Irish-bred gelding Jethro proving four seconds in arrears, but sufficient to take the second HOYS place.

Sixteen year-old Robert Murphy from Preston, Lancashire claimed the third qualifying position on new ride Uncanny, an 8-year-old gelding owned by Sasha Moore, that he has ridden for only two weeks.

With the three direct qualifying tickets for the Squibb Group Pony Foxhunter Championship Final at the Horse of the Year Show having been allocated, the combinations in fourth and fifth took home the chance to compete in the Squibb Group Pony Foxhunter Masters at the British Showjumping National Championships.

Bishop Burton – Saturday 8th July 2016

Squibb Group Pony Foxhunter Second Round

1st Alexander McLean & Tobar King – 0/0/0 - 40.94 seconds

2nd Ella Popely & Jethro – 0/0/0 - 44.96 seconds

3rd Robert Murphy & Uncanny – 0/0/0 - 45.01 seconds

4th Fraser Reed & Jiminy Cricket – 0/0/0 - 45.81 seconds

5th Ryan Lockwood & Nelly III – 0/0/0 - 46.61 seconds

The Horse of the Year Show 2016 will take place from the 5th – 9th October at Birmingham’s NEC. The British Showjumping National Championships 2016 will take place during the 9th – 14th August at the National Agricultural and Exhibition Centre (NAEC), Stoneleigh Park, Warwickshire.    

Squibb Group:

With more than 60 years’ industry experience, Squibb Group is widely regarded as one of the UK’s foremost demolition contractors.

The company utilises a highly-experienced and well-trained team to deliver a full range of demolition methods and techniques including deconstruction and dismantling, top-down, high reach, facade retention, and explosive demolition. This broad expertise allows Squibb Group to work in an equally varied range of applications from houses to high-rise city centre structures, and from airport terminals to petrochemical works.
